Texas A&M AgriLife Research is soliciting bids for a Whitley A45 (or equivalent) anaerobic workstation with a three-port system, anaerobic monitoring, and touchscreen controls. Vendors must provide unit prices, delivery estimates, and complete technical specifications including installation and training requirements. The solicitation includes a one-year warranty for parts and labor and has an estimated budget between $50,000 and $200,000.

The City of Richland, Washington is soliciting Statements of Qualifications from professional engineering firms to provide engineering design, bid-ready documents, and contract specifications for replacement and rehabilitation of the City’s wastewater treatment plant anaerobic digesters with steel gas holder covers. The procurement is posted and administered on the City’s official PublicPurchase portal. Submittals are due on February 10, 2026 at 3:00 p.m. Pacific Time.
